lever?
Hey,new member and a couple questions. Is there a lever for 4/2WD? I got most of the symbols on the levers figured out. Tractor came without manuals. A good source for downloadable PDF manuals would be appreciated. BTW this is a Kabota BX23 THANKS

Re: lever?
Not sure if its the same but on the BX24 its on the right fender all the way down on the front of the fender right hand side lever. Its real stubby. Good luck. Try Kubotabooks.com also

Anyhow, keyman is right if it's a BX. And don't force it either way. If it seems like it's not going into or out of 4wd, turn the wheels with the steering wheel either way (full turns) a few times and it will click right in.
